SAÚL SARABIA: HEALING THROUGH VOTING Saul Sarabia expresses, “Civic participation, owning my civic voice, and taking collective action with other people, is healing work.” Listen to affirm how our voices are more than just a vote.
RAMONA MERCHAN: HEALING THROUGH ANTI-RACIST ACTIVISM Join us for a conversation with experienced trainer, coach, advocate, and leader, Ramona Merchan who shares the meaning of anti-racist activism and how we as a community and individuals can heal through it. Ramona offers her impactful story and what brought her to assisting vulnerable and marginalized communities through anti-racist advocacy.
SALINA GRAY: HEALING THROUGH MINDFULNESS Join us for a conversation with Salina Gray, a teacher with 24 years in traditional public, charter, and graduate schools. She shares her story and vulnerability on how she has made her way to heal through mindfulness. Salina reveals, “the first step is to sit with yourself.”
YEHUDAH PRYCE: HEALING THROUGH FAITH Join us for a conversation with Yehudah Pryce, who sees faith as a liberating and redemptive force to confront trauma in a sustaining way that transcends structural barriers and oppressive forces.
